About Truist Bank PDF Statements
Truist Bank bank statements are typically downloaded as PDF files from online banking portals. While these PDFs are easy to read, extracting transaction data manually can be time-consuming.
MintConvert extracts the transaction table from your Truist statement and converts it into structured data. Each transaction — including date, description, debit, credit, and balance — is parsed and exported into clean formats like CSV or Excel.
Truist Bank (formerly BB&T and SunTrust) statement PDFs are downloadable via Truist Online Banking. Both legacy account formats are supported. Truist PDFs may show the legacy BB&T or SunTrust header depending on account origin. MintConvert handles both header formats and normalises output to the same column structure.

How do I download my Truist Bank statement as a PDF?
Log in to Truist Online Banking → Account Services → Statements → Select account and period → Download PDF.
